Hanuman Welch has been Apple Music’s leading editorial news anchor since Apple Music’s launch. In 2020, he became the face and voice of ALT CTRL With Hanuman, shining a light on forward-leaning, boundary-pushing music from around the world, as featured on Apple Music’s popular ALT CTRL playlist. ALT CTRL is a home for artists (and like-minded listeners) who see the world a bit differently, whether they gravitate towards guitars, electronics, or a modern collision of the two. On the show, Hanuman provides unique context around the playlist and its eclectic range of music, speaking to artists as disparate as The 1975, Billie Eilish, and White Reaper—always helping listeners to connect the dots between them. It airs weekly on Apple Music 1 Fridays at 7 a.m. PT.
